This song was inspired by a milestone that feels hard to believe. This year marks 45 years since I met my husband and nearly 42 years of marriage. When we first met, I never could have imagined all the experiences we would share together. Over the years, we’ve celebrated happy occasions, raised a family, faced challenges, learned from mistakes, and created countless memories. Through all the ups and downs we have stayed committed to each other.
As I look back, I recognize that our love has been built through patience, forgiveness, friendship, and choosing each other again and again. Those ideas became the foundation for this song.
One of my favorite lines is:
“Live in the present, learn from the past, create our future with love that lasts.”
I think there is wisdom in remembering where we’ve been, appreciating where we are today, and continuing to move forward together.
I’m so grateful for Terry, for our family, and for the many experiences we’ve shared. I’m also grateful for everyone who has encouraged my music over the years.
I hope Meant to be Together brings you good memories, hope, and an appreciation for those who have influenced your life.
